he provincial education office in Jambi has announced that all schools in the province will close during the Islamic fasting month of Ramadhan, starting on June 6.
“During the Islamic month of Ramadhan, students are encouraged to seek moral and spiritual improvement,” the education office head Rahmat Derita said on Sunday.
He said he hoped parents and the community would both play a role in facilitating religious activities for school students during the school break.
“The holiday is not intended as a pause in the learning process. Students can learn [spirituality and morals] at home with their parents and or from their surroundings,” he added.
